#发文集龍卡瓜分百万现金#2、React Beautiful DND:让拖拽体验更加美观流畅在现代网页设计中,拖拽功能不仅仅是一种交互方式,更是提升用户体验的重要手段。React Beautiful DND(Drag and Drop)是一个专门为React开发的库,旨在提供一个美观、流畅的拖拽体验。它通过简洁的API和灵活的配置选项,让开发者能够轻松实现复...
react-beautiful-dnd更好一些没什么问题,使用起来很流畅,唯一的缺点我感觉是库大了一些,比其他两个的包要更大些 react-sortable-hoc在page列表过长,需要滑动的列表中拖拽时,滑动后位置不匹配会发生偏移
react-beautiful-dnd : 拖放 react-dnd : 拖放 react-grid-layout : 具有响应断点的可拖动和可调整大小的网格布局 react-data-grid : 类似Excel的网格组件 react-draggable : 拖动 react-resizable-and-movable : 调整大小与拖动 react-resizable : 调整大小 react-resizable-box : 调整大小 react-spaces : 支持...
React DnD是React和Redux核心作者 Dan Abramov创造的一组React 高阶组件,可以在保持组件分离的前提下帮助构建复杂的拖放接口。主要用于组件的拖放。 npm地址:npmjs.com/package/react 3. react-beautiful-dnd react-beautiful-dnd是一款美观且简单易用的 React 列表拖拽库。 npm地址:npmjs.com/package/react 4...
React-beautiful-dnd 是一个用于构建 Web 应用程序的拖放库。 React-beautiful-dnd 支持多种拖放类型,...
本篇文章主要介绍react-beautiful-dnd,它是基于react的拖拽插件 接下来会从以下几个方面来介绍react-beautiful-dnd 安装使用 API介绍 Example 1. 安装使用 首先我们需要安装react-beautiful-dnd # yarn yarn add re
Rekit是开源的一个脚手架,用于使用 React、Redux 和 React-router 构建可扩展的 Web 应用程序。它可以帮助开发人员专注于业务逻辑,而不是处理大量的库、模式、配置等。 Github:https://github.com/rekit/rekit 5、应用调试 (1)React Developer Tools
React-beautiful-dnd(简称RDD)是一款用于React应用中的强大拖拽库,它能够帮助开发者轻松实现可交互、美观且响应式的拖拽功能。RDD设计简洁,易于与其他React应用集成,同时提供了丰富的API和插件,支持多种拖拽交互场景。 安装与导入 首先,确保你的项目中已经安装了react和react-dom。接下来,通过npm或yarn安装RDD: ...
npm i react-dnd-html5-backend 2.创建一个 index.js 文件 DndProvider组件为您的应用程序提供 React-DnD 功能。这必须通过 backend 支柱注入后端,但也可以注入 window 物体。 backend:必填。一个React DnD后端。除非您正在编写自定义的,否则您可能希望使用React DnD附带的HTML5后端。
在React中实现拖拽排序功能,有几个流行的库可供选择,如React-dnd、react-beautiful-dnd、dnd-kit和react-sortable-hoc。每种库都有其独特的设计理念和组件结构。React-dnd以其Backend、Item、Type、Monitor和Connector等核心概念,支持自定义事件处理和DOM操作,如DragSource和DropTarget组件。通过codesandbox....